Hi Dara,

Welcome to the Quillbrook on-call rotation. Quick heads-up before your first shift: the Fenwick upstream API flaps most weeknights, and our circuit breaker in the ledger-sync service trips at 40% error rate. Don't restart the pod — let the breaker half-open on its own. If it stays open past 15 minutes, page platform. The breaker thresholds, override procedure, and escalation steps are documented on the internal page here.

runbook for yajog-tahag: https://jira.norvasys.corp/spaces/job/display/ca5ff3fa4d4d

### Changelog — Tracewing 4.2

Default tracing behavior changed: spans now propagate across all Brindleton microservices automatically, and sampling dropped from 100% to adaptive. New services inherit these defaults unless overridden, so don't re-add manual instrumentation. Head-based sampling is gone. The new default configuration shipped with this release is shown below.

config for kafof-bawef:
holath:
  log_level: debug
  metrics_host: metrics.holath.qorvelsys.internal
  pin: 2191
  pool_size: 32

Subject: DR drill — Stormrelay fan-out

Reviewers: Thursday we run the disaster-recovery drill for the Stormrelay weather-alert fan-out. Scope: kill the primary broker, confirm alerts reroute through the standby region within 90 seconds, verify no duplicate pushes. Review the failover diff before the drill; flag anything touching the dedupe window. Logs land in the sealed drill bucket. Standby credentials were rotated yesterday, so old notes are stale. To unlock the drill bucket after the exercise, use the passphrase below.

vault phrase of hahop-badug = novvan-ulaion-zorius-noviel-gorwyn-casix-tamys

Q3 Planning Note — Dept Heads Only

Quick heads-up: the Orvane Systems division is under a hiring freeze through end of quarter. No new reqs, no backfills without sign-off from Marla in People Ops. Contractors already onboarded can stay. Yes, it's annoying; yes, it's temporary. The reasoning ties into wider plans, summarised in the confidential note below.

board note of kageg-bahof: The renewal with Holwynax Holdings closes at $2 million a year, 5 percent below the last contract. Project Ulaath slips by two quarters because of the supplier delay.